Position Summary
The Experienced Fire Sprinkler Designer is responsible for developing accurate, code-compliant fire sprinkler system designs and producing the drawings, calculations, and related documentation necessary to clearly communicate the project scope to customers, project teams, authorities having jurisdiction, and field installation personnel.
The Designer works closely with project managers, sales personnel, field teams, and other members of the organization to ensure fire sprinkler systems are designed accurately, efficiently, and in accordance with applicable codes, standards, project specifications, and company requirements.
Essential Responsibilities
Prepare fire sprinkler system drawings and design documentation for commercial and other assigned projects.
Develop designs in accordance with applicable NFPA standards, local codes, project specifications, and AHJ requirements.
Perform hydraulic calculations and coordinate system requirements as necessary.
Review architectural, structural, mechanical, and other construction documents to identify information affecting sprinkler system design.
Coordinate sprinkler system layouts with other building systems and trades.
Prepare accurate material and fabrication information to support field installation.
Revise drawings and designs based on field conditions, project changes, coordination requirements, and AHJ comments.
Work closely with project managers, field personnel, and other departments to resolve design and installation issues.
Maintain organized and accurate project documentation.
Assist and provide technical guidance to less-experienced designers when assigned.
Manage multiple projects and priorities while meeting project schedules and deadlines.
Participate in project coordination meetings as required.
Qualifications
High school diploma or equivalent required.
Minimum of two years of fire sprinkler design experience with a design-build fire sprinkler contractor required.
Experience using AutoCAD and HydraCAD or comparable fire sprinkler design software.
Working knowledge of applicable NFPA fire sprinkler standards, construction practices, and fire protection system requirements.
Strong understanding of fire sprinkler materials, equipment, installation methods, and design processes.
Ability to read and interpret architectural, structural, mechanical, and construction drawings.
Strong organizational, planning, and time-management skills.
Strong written and verbal communication skills.
Ability to work independently while also collaborating effectively with project teams.
Ability to manage multiple assignments and adjust priorities as project needs change.
Strong attention to detail, accuracy, and quality.
Valid driver's license and ability to meet company insurance requirements.
Preferred Qualifications
NICET certification in Water-Based Systems Layout.
Experience performing hydraulic calculations.
Experience coordinating complex commercial fire sprinkler projects.
Field installation or fire sprinkler construction experience.
Experience mentoring or assisting junior designers.

Wiginton Fire Systems (Wiginton) designs, fabricates, installs and maintains fire sprinkler systems. We also service and maintain fire alarm and chemical based suppression and handheld equipment for our fire sprinkler system clients. Wiginton is headquartered in Sanford, Florida, and operates full-service branch offices in Jacksonville, Orlando, West Palm Beach, Tampa, Miami and Atlanta, GA. The Jacksonville branch is supported by regional service offices in Pensacola and Gainesville. The Orlando branch is supported by regional service offices in Daytona Beach and Melbourne. The Tampa branch is supported by a regional service office in Ft. Myers.
